Photographing Orchids
U.S. Botanic Garden
Washington, DC
Dates: Saturday and Sunday
March 3 and 4, 2012
Time: 8:00 AM– 4:00 PM
Instructor: Joshua Taylor, Jr.
This two-day workshop is designed for photo enthusiasts who want to capture striking images of orchids. The workshop will emphasize how to capture the natural beauty of orchids through composition, light and background control, and close-up photography. Class time will include instruction on digital capture, processing techniques, and an introduction to photo editing software, such as Photoshop, Photoshop Elements, Nik Color Efex Pro Filters, Topaz Adjust and Simplify, etc. The instructor will provide an illustrated handout, critiques, and assistance during shooting time in the exhibition areas. The last session will be a formal critique of participants’ images. To help participants to capture the best possible orchid images, the following items are recommended: bring ALL photo equipment; a tripod is optional, but highly recommended; a memory card with ample digital capture space; camera manual; a fully charged and extra camera battery.
Note: Participants should have a working knowledge of their camera. Some activities are NOT applicable to point–n–shoot cameras.
